The community in Whorlton presents a clear demographic profile that reflects its status as a long-established rural settlement. You find that 76% of households are owner-occupied, indicating a population deeply rooted in the area rather than renters moving through on short contracts. This high level of local investment suggests stability within the neighbourhood, where families and long-term residents build deep ties to their properties. Age is a defining feature of life here, with a median age of 70 years. You will notice that the most common age grouping represents those over the age of 60, meaning the village caters primarily to retirees rather than young families or students.
